How to Turn Traffic into Leads & Maximise Your Conversion Rate?

Turning website traffic into leads is both an art and a science. Conversion Rate Optimization (CRO) is all about making your website more effective at turning visitors into customers. In this guide, we’ll cover basic to advanced techniques and provide examples to illustrate how each tactic works.

1. What is Conversion Rate Optimization (CRO)?

CRO refers to the process of improving your website’s elements—like design, content, and user experience—to increase the percentage of visitors who convert into leads or customers.

Conversion Rate=(Total VisitorsTotal Conversions)×100


Let’s say you have an e-commerce website that gets 10,000 visitors a month, and 200 of them make a purchase. Your conversion rate would be:

Conversion Rate=( 200/10,000)×100=2%

If you apply CRO techniques and increase the conversion rate to 4%, you’re now converting 400 customers from the same traffic volume. That’s double the revenue without having to drive more traffic!

2. The Importance of Traffic vs. Leads

It’s tempting to focus solely on driving traffic, but traffic alone doesn’t guarantee sales. What’s critical is converting that traffic into leads and eventually customers. The truth is, no matter how much traffic you drive to your website, if it’s not converting, your efforts are wasted.

Driving targeted traffic is essential, but turning traffic into leads and leads into customers is where true business growth happens. This is where CRO comes into play.


Imagine you run a PPC (Pay-Per-Click) campaign targeting the keyword “cheap shoes.” If you sell high-end shoes, you might drive a lot of traffic from this keyword, but these visitors are unlikely to convert because they’re looking for something inexpensive. Targeting “luxury shoes” would likely yield fewer visitors but a higher conversion rate, turning more traffic into leads.

3. Understanding Your Audience

Before diving into the technicalities of CRO, it’s crucial to understand your audience. Without knowing what your visitors want, any optimization strategy could be misdirected. Here are a few ways to better understand your audience:

  • Conduct Surveys: Ask users why they visited your site, what they liked, and what stopped them from converting.
  • Utilize Google Analytics: Analyze user behavior, traffic sources, and demographics to identify high-converting traffic.
  • Build Customer Personas: Create detailed profiles of your ideal customers, including their needs, pain points, and buying motivations.


If you’re an online service offering accounting solutions for small businesses, understanding your audience’s challenges (e.g., managing cash flow, tax prep) allows you to create specific content and CTAs addressing those issues. A CTA like “Struggling with year-end taxes? Get a free consultation!” speaks directly to their pain point and encourages conversions.

4. Basic CRO Tactics

Now that you understand your audience, let’s begin with the basic CRO strategies that form the foundation of high conversion rates.

Optimizing Your Website for Mobile

With mobile traffic surpassing desktop, a mobile-optimized website is essential. Ensure your design is responsive, and your forms are easy to fill out on mobile devices. Google also uses mobile-first indexing, so this step will improve your SEO.

Improving Website Speed

Site speed is a critical factor in both user experience and SEO. A one-second delay can result in a 7% reduction in conversions. Use tools like Google PageSpeed Insights and GTmetrix to assess and optimize your website’s speed.

Crafting Clear and Compelling CTAs

Your Call-to-Action (CTA) buttons are one of the most important elements of your website. Ensure they are clear, compelling, and stand out visually. Phrases like “Get Started Now” or “Claim Your Free Trial” perform better than generic CTAs like “Submit.”

Implementing User-Friendly Navigation

Your website should be easy to navigate. Complex menus or cluttered layouts frustrate users and increase bounce rates. Simplify navigation, use a logical structure, and ensure important sections are easily accessible.


A case study by MobileMonkey showed that they increased mobile conversions by 150% after optimizing their website for mobile. They simplified the design, removed unnecessary pop-ups, and made forms easier to fill out on smaller screens.

Improving Website Speed

Website speed is crucial. A slow-loading page can increase bounce rates and drastically reduce conversions.


Amazon famously reported that for every 100 milliseconds of latency on their website, they lost 1% in sales. By optimizing your website’s images, scripts, and overall load time using tools like Google PageSpeed Insights, you can see significant improvements.

Crafting Clear and Compelling CTAs

The Call-to-Action (CTA) is what prompts users to take the next step. Make your CTA buttons stand out and ensure they’re action-oriented.


Crazy Egg, a heatmapping tool, improved conversions by 64% by changing their CTA from “See Plans and Pricing” to “Show Me My Heatmap.” The new CTA was more engaging and aligned with the user’s intent, leading to a higher click-through rate.

Implementing User-Friendly Navigation

Simplified navigation helps users find what they need quickly, which increases the chances they’ll convert.


Zappos improved their conversion rate by making their navigation more user-friendly, adding a prominent search bar, and categorizing products more logically. As a result, visitors spent more time on the site and added more products to their carts.

5. Intermediate CRO Strategies

Once the basics are in place, it’s time to step up your CRO game with more advanced strategies.

A/B Testing Your Pages

A/B testing allows you to compare two versions of a page to see which one performs better. You can test headlines, images, CTAs, and even the overall design. Tools like Optimizely or VWO are great for A/B testing.

Using Social Proof

Social proof is a powerful psychological trigger. Adding testimonials, customer reviews, and trust badges can build credibility and encourage visitors to convert. Highlight case studies or show the number of customers who’ve already signed up.

Utilizing Heatmaps and Analytics

Tools like Hotjar or Crazy Egg provide heatmaps, showing where users click, scroll, or hover on your website. This helps you understand user behavior and optimize pages accordingly.

Building Trust with Testimonials and Reviews

Trust is a major factor in conversion. Showcase reviews from satisfied customers and include clear, compelling testimonials. Video testimonials are especially effective, as they add a personal touch.

Example: masterfully uses social proof by showing how many people are currently viewing the same hotel or how many bookings have been made in the last hour. This creates urgency and reassures potential customers that the hotel is popular and in demand.

Utilizing Heatmaps and Analytics

Heatmaps help you see where users are clicking, scrolling, and interacting on your website.


A heatmap analysis of an e-commerce store might reveal that users are clicking more on images than on the “Add to Cart” button. By adjusting the layout and making the “Add to Cart” button more prominent, you can improve conversions.

6. Advanced CRO Techniques

For those who want to push the envelope, these advanced techniques can help you take your conversions to the next level.

Personalizing User Experience

Personalization can significantly improve user engagement and conversion rates. Use dynamic content to show tailored offers or product recommendations based on user behavior, location, or previous interactions.

Creating Dedicated Landing Pages

Instead of sending all traffic to a generic homepage, create dedicated landing pages for specific campaigns or audiences. Tailor your messaging, visuals, and CTAs to match the intent of the visitor. Landing pages typically have higher conversion rates than homepages.

Leveraging AI and Chatbots for Lead Generation

AI-powered chatbots can engage with users in real-time, answer their questions, and guide them towards conversion. Tools like Drift and Intercom allow you to create automated chat sequences to qualify leads and collect contact information.

Integrating CRM Systems

A customer relationship management (CRM) system helps you track and manage leads more effectively. By integrating CRM tools like HubSpot or Salesforce, you can monitor user activity, set up automated follow-ups, and segment leads for more targeted campaigns.


Amazon personalizes its product recommendations based on browsing history, past purchases, and search queries. This hyper-targeted approach increases the chances of conversion as users are more likely to buy something that’s relevant to their needs.

Creating Dedicated Landing Pages

Sending users to a specific landing page that aligns with their intent will improve your conversion rate compared to directing them to a generic homepage.


Unbounce created dedicated landing pages for their Google Ads campaigns, aligning the copy and design with the keywords being targeted. This resulted in a 43% increase in conversions compared to sending traffic to their homepage.

Leveraging AI and Chatbots for Lead Generation

AI-powered chatbots can help guide users through your site and collect information, turning them into leads.


Drift, a conversational marketing platform, uses AI chatbots to engage website visitors in real-time. Their bot qualifies leads by asking relevant questions and directing them to the appropriate resources or human agents, significantly increasing lead generation.

7. Content Marketing to Drive Conversions

Content marketing plays a crucial role in driving conversions. High-quality, relevant content builds trust and positions you as an authority in your niche.

  • Create In-Depth Guides: Provide value by creating long-form content that solves your audience’s problems. This establishes credibility and encourages users to engage with your brand.
  • Use Content Upgrades: Offer exclusive content like ebooks or checklists in exchange for email addresses. This turns casual readers into leads.
  • Optimize Blog CTAs: Each blog post should include relevant CTAs. Whether it’s subscribing to a newsletter or downloading a free resource, encourage users to take action.


A SaaS company could offer a comprehensive guide like “How to Automate Your Workflow” as a lead magnet in exchange for users’ emails. Once the guide is downloaded, follow-up emails could nurture the lead into scheduling a demo or purchasing the service.

8. Email Marketing and Remarketing for Nurturing Leads

Once you’ve captured a lead, the next step is nurturing them into customers.

Email Drip Campaigns

Set up email sequences to nurture leads over time. Provide valuable content, special offers, or product updates that gradually guide leads down the sales funnel.

Remarketing Ads

Remarketing targets users who’ve already visited your site but didn’t convert. With tools like Google Ads and Facebook Ads, you can display personalized ads to these users as they browse the web, reminding them to return and complete the conversion.


HubSpot uses automated email workflows to send personalized content to leads based on their behavior. If a visitor downloads an e-book, they’ll be automatically enrolled in an email sequence that sends related blog posts, case studies, and offers—nurturing them toward a purchase.

9. The Role of PPC in Conversions

Pay-Per-Click (PPC) advertising can drive targeted traffic to your site, increasing the likelihood of conversions. Ensure your PPC ads align with user intent and drive traffic to dedicated landing pages.

Google Ads

Google Ads allows you to target users actively searching for your product or service. Use specific keywords and create compelling ad copy that encourages clicks.

Social Media Ads

Platforms like Facebook and Instagram allow for highly targeted advertising. Use lookalike audiences to reach potential leads and drive them to custom landing pages designed for conversions.

10. Measuring Your CRO Success

To know if your efforts are working, it’s essential to measure your results. Use tools like Google Analytics to track key performance indicators (KPIs) such as:

  • Conversion Rate
  • Bounce Rate
  • Average Time on Site
  • Pages per Visit

Set up goals in Google Analytics to track conversions and monitor which traffic sources or campaigns generate the most leads. Continuously test and refine your strategies for ongoing improvement.


Using Google Analytics, you can track metrics like bounce rate, conversion rate, and average session duration. If you notice a high bounce rate on a key landing page, you might run A/B tests or change the CTA to encourage more engagement.


Whether you’re just starting with CRO or looking to optimize an established website, these techniques—combined with real-life examples—will help you turn traffic into leads and maximize your conversion rate. From basic strategies like improving website speed to advanced tactics like personalizing the user experience, CRO is an ongoing process of testing, refining, and improving.

By focusing on the user’s journey and eliminating any barriers to conversion, you’ll see your efforts pay off in the form of increased leads, customers, and revenue.